According to Rob Demovsky of ESPN, the Cleveland Browns were one of three teams to conduct an interview with former Miami Dolphins head coach Joe Philbin. Most recently, Philbin served as offensive coordinator and interim head coach for the Green Bay Packers.
As Pro Football Talk points out, it is unknown what position Philbin interviewed for with the Browns. His background is in working with the offensive line, but Cleveland already hired James Campen the other day to be their offensive line coach/assistant head coach to Freddie Kitchens.
With Philbin’s experience, I expect him to get a more prominent role elsewhere, rather than settling for a less prominent assistant role in Cleveland. Nonetheless, it’ll be curious to hear what position he did interview for.
